Strata living in Victoria is governed by the Owners Corporations Act 2006, and a range of resources are available to help apartment owners, residents, and committee members navigate their responsibilities and build stronger communities.
Whether you are managing common property, attending committee meetings, or resolving disputes, Victoria’s guides offer practical advice to support informed decision-making and harmonious living.
Key topics include:
- The role of owners corporations and committees
- Financial management and record keeping
- Common property and maintenance
- Insurance and sustainability
- Dispute resolution and communication
Whether you are new to strata or an experienced committee member, these resources are designed to help you make strata living work for you.
